The blower wheel keeps coming loose and makes a terible racket when it runs. I've tightened the clamp but this time it doesn't seem to stop the wheel from slipping and rubbing against the housing and making that racket again. It also won't dry properly with this noise. Should I just try to replace the clamp with a small hose clamp?

Originally Posted by: lspaper ...Should I just try to replace the clamp with a small hose clamp?... No. Any clamp would not help because the center hole in the blower wheel is worn out. The solution is to replace the blower wheel. - The blower wheel Part number: AP4294048
